Based on the battle proven Panzer III hull, replacing the turret with an armoured superstructure containing a more powerful gun; the 7.5cm StuK 40 L/48. It had a crew of four - commander, driver, gunner & loader. 

The StuG III was second only to the Sd.Kfz 251 Hanomag as Germany's most produced fighting vehicle of WWII. Over 10,000 were built during the war with 300 Ausf B versions built between June 1940 & May 1941. The Ausf B was the first mass produced version of the StuG III and saw extensive action in the Balkans and in Operation Barbarossa.
